Seabirds are birds adapted for life in marine environments. While they vary greatly, most share characteristics like a longer lifespan, delayed breeding, and high migratory patterns.

Many "true" seabirds (tubenoses) have specialized salt glands to excrete excess salt from seawater. seabird
